Five Basic Ingredients Are All It Takes

Plus a few spices of your choice

Here is a preview of what you will need:


2 cups of elbow noodles (or the small package). Cook them al dente.
1 can cream of chicken soup. (Campbell's Healthy Request or 98% Fat Free are both good choices for excellent flavor)
1 8-10oz package of sharp cheddar cheese
1/2 cup of milk (I use 1%)
1/2 cup mayonnaise

Elbow Noodles


Cook some kind of elbow noodles for the least amount of time suggested on the box.

You want them to be al dente and not mushy.

They will be doing more cooking in the oven.

Soup, Milk and Mayonnaise Make a Delicious Sauce


Open the can of cream of chicken soup (Healthy Request or Campbell's 98% Fat Free are both good) and put it into a large bowl. One with a handle is helpful.

Add 1/2 cup of Mayo and slowly whisk in the1/2 cup of milk.

Add Your Choice of Flavors and Spices

Once the soup, milk and mayo are combined, add your choice of flavor enhancements- or don't, it's up to you.

I seldom add salt to anything I cook and the soup makes this dish salty enough, but a little black pepper and onion powder will add good flavor and I personally like to add garlic and flax seed meal.

(Flax seed meal is just a healthy addition and doesn't do much for the flavor. I try to sneak it into many things I make for it's extreme health benefits.)

Shred Blocks of Cheese

Shred Your Own Cheese


I usually use sharp, yellow, good quality cheddar cheese. White cheddar also works, but the finished product won't be yellow. (You can add a sprinkle of Tumeric spice for a yellow color).

I sometimes combine cheeses and add some Havarti for a different flavor.

The most important thing, in my opinion, is to shred a block of cheese instead of using pre-shredded, store bought cheese, that doesn't have much flavor.

The Sauce Mixture


Once the soup, mayonnaise and milk are mixed, and the spices added, stir in the shredded cheese.

Then add the cooked noodles and stir it all up.

Bake and Eat!


Grease a round or square, deep baking dish and pour the mixture in.

Bake at 350 degrees for 30-40 minutes or until bubbly at the edges.
